== Transporting the Quarterly Stock-Count Ledger ==

The master ledger for the Brindell warehouse stock count is a controlled document and may not be copied or scanned before sign-off. At quarter close, the shift lead places the ledger in the grey transit sleeve, records the seal number in the movement log, and arranges courier pickup to the Farrowgate records office. The ledger travels alone — no co-mingled freight. The confidential hand-over instruction for the courier appears directly below.

courier memo of yawep-yafog: the pramir ulaix courier leaves the ulavan aldix frair zorok oliiel joreth rusdor fenvan ledger at gate 1305 under passcode 514738

This page covers loan pieces moving between the Selwick Institute and partner venues. Dispatch desk: every loaned piece travels with its condition report, packed by the registrar and sealed in a numbered case. Cases must be booked onto climate-controlled vehicles only, with a two-person sign-off at departure. The current loan — four framed studies bound for the Corvell Gallery — leaves Monday at 08:00. Routes are not to be shared outside the desk. At collection, the courier receives the following instruction.

handover note for yagef-bagep: the drudor pelius courier leaves the kasdor zorvan norir ledger at gate 8016 under passcode 755406

## Releases

Hey support folks — quick notes on ProfileMesh shard releases. Each release re-balances user-profile shards gradually, so don't panic if a lookup lands on a stale shard for a few minutes post-deploy; it self-heals. Release bundles are published twice a month and are always signed. If a customer asks you to verify a bundle they downloaded, walk them through the checksum step using the public signing key below.

deploy key for kawif-bageg: bky19_YQNdHDgpaLxUNwPoHm9

## Approvals — Audit-Log Viewer (Project Slatewick)

Access to the Slatewick audit-log viewer is approval-gated. Read access requires a recorded business justification; export access requires a second approval from the compliance rotation. Approvals expire after 90 days and are re-reviewed quarterly. Security reviewers should confirm that no standing export grants exist outside the compliance group. All approval decisions are logged and ultimately accountable to the named owner of this control.

signatory, kaweg-fawig: Zorys Druys Jorius Novael